do they make you really fill in the PR Card Application when you land? It says to list the last employers for the past 5 years...it took us 2 sheets with our PR application...
 
No, you won't fill in a PR card application on landing. You will confirm your address and the first card is emailed to you after your landing. You need your passport with visa and COPR, Goods list (B4) and take a couple immigration-sized photos as a just-in-case. That's it.

No, the first card is delivered to you in regular mail (rather than email) after landing.
